Output 305f477dd98e9e97950c0c590d256d6d987a71695043377f30cb3abef88b32b9:0

value
26904894
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c896b14d7acf92d05bd0d24a84cb98e883fbf965 OP_EQUALVERIFY OP_CHECKSIG
address
1KHcffuCZaKLZePVUhGMisfrEAAdkJhLrc
transaction
305f477dd98e9e97950c0c590d256d6d987a71695043377f30cb3abef88b32b9
spent
true